Output 50313ab4fa7973af2c95309247f637e4ec5ada1e884b49f1b03cd7e1defe3ba0:39

value
23907
script pubkey
OP_HASH160 OP_PUSHBYTES_20 989dab16c21724c44822ada7cee930f8836c6bef OP_EQUAL
address
3FbyWgtoEHgMH7qyV3fqn8mo86haKy9UPc
transaction
50313ab4fa7973af2c95309247f637e4ec5ada1e884b49f1b03cd7e1defe3ba0
confirmations
78879
spent
true